FIRST DIRECT FLUORINATION OF TYROSINE-CONTAINING BIOLOGICALLY ACTIVE PEPTIDES
Hebel, D.,Kirk, K.L.,Cohen, L.A.,Labroo, V.M.
, p. 619 - 622 (1990)
Using acetyl hypofluorite a regiospecific electrophilic fluorination of the tyrosine ring of the N-terminal tetrapeptide amide (Tyr-D-Ala-Phe-Gly-NH2) sequence of the opiate peptide dermorphin has been achieved in good yields.
